| Emisor | Velia |
|---|---|
| Año | 300 BC - 280 BC |
| Tipo | Standard circulation coin |
| Valor | Didrachm (2) |
| Moneda | Phocaean/Campanian Drachm |
| Composición | Silver |
| Peso | 7.35 g |
| Diámetro | 21.5 mm |
| Grosor | |
| Forma | Round (irregular) |
| Técnica | Hammered |
| Orientación | Variable alignment ↺ |
| Grabador(es) | |
| En circulación hasta | |
| Referencia(s) | HN Italy#1302 , Williams#397-405 Ashmolean#1308 Lockett#560 2#1354 |
| Descripción del anverso | Head of Athena right, wearing crested Attic helmet decorated on the bowl with chariot or griffin, sometimes griffin on the neck guard, ΦΙΛΙΣ or ΤΙΩΝΟΣ or Φ behind neck. |
|---|---|
| Escritura del anverso | Greek |
| Leyenda del anverso | Φ |
| Descripción del reverso | Lion standing right on ground line; YEΛHTΩN above; in exergue, vine-spray, leaf or grapes, sometimes Φ-I. |
| Escritura del reverso | Greek |
| Leyenda del reverso | YEΛHTΩN Φ I |
